Why doesn't ChatGPT mention my business?

The short answer

ChatGPT and other large language models (LLMs) recommend businesses they can find and trust. If your business information is inconsistent, your website doesn't clearly explain what you do, or few other sites mention you, AI tools have little reason to include you in their answers.

What an LLM is

An LLM, or large language model, is the technology behind AI assistants like ChatGPT, Claude, and Gemini. Many of them can search the web and summarize what they find. More and more, they're the first place people go when choosing a business.

How to become easier to recommend

  • Keep your name, address, phone, and services identical everywhere they appear online
  • Keep a steady flow of recent, detailed reviews
  • Write pages that answer specific questions in plain language
  • Get mentioned by others: local directories, partners, your chamber, and the press
  • Make sure your website loads fast and isn't blocking search tools

Check where you stand

Ask a few AI tools the questions your customers ask, like “Who's the best [service] near [city]?” Note who shows up and why. That tells you what to strengthen first.

The bottom line

The more consistent and trustworthy signals you send, the easier you are for AI tools to find and recommend.
